The Delhi High Court on Wednesday issued discover to the Center on a petition filed by the Press Trust of India, alleging that the IT Rules, 2021 heralds an “era of surveillance and fear”, which might end in self-censorship. Challenging the constitutional validity of the principles, the nation’s largest information company argued that the principles would solely support in concentrating on publishers of reports and present affairs content material.

A division bench of Chief Justice DN Patel and Justice JR Midha issued the discover and listed it for listening to on August 20. Similar petitions difficult the applicability of IT guidelines on digital media are additionally pending within the High Court.

The petition, filed by way of advocates Wasim Baig and Swarnendu Chatterjee, argued that Part III of the Rules govern authorities oversight on digital information portals, a ‘code of conduct’ that seeks to ascertain “vague situations” similar to “good taste”, “decency”, prohibition. “determines. “Half-true”, and “drastic” penalties for perceived non-compliance.

“The Central Government (Executive) … will virtually direct the content of digital news portals through ‘Impgunded Rules’ and the rules will help target only a specific segment, inter alia, ‘publishers of news and current affairs content’. ‘. This would expressly and categorically violate Articles 14 and 19(1)(a) of the Constitution,” the petition mentioned. “These rules shall only be in the content of online digital news portals for executive or state are meant to be a weapon to enter and directly control.”

Meanwhile, a division bench of Chief Justice Patel and Justice Jyoti Singh refused to grant interim aid within the petitions filed by Quint Digital Media Ltd and its director Ritu Kapoor; Foundation for Independent Journalism which publishes The Wire; Pravda Media Foundation, which owns the fact-checking web site Alt News and others.

The Center additionally instructed the court docket that it has filed a petition earlier than the Supreme Court to maneuver all of the petitions difficult the IT guidelines earlier than varied excessive courts. The court docket, whereas directing the Center to file its reply within the circumstances, listed them for listening to on August 20.
